Concern About Planned Pedestrianisation Of Ennis Town Centre For Christmas

Concern is being expressed about the scale of road closures being considered for peak shopping times in Ennis this Christmas.

O’Connell Street is already pedestrianised for weekends in the lead up to December 25th to allow shoppers to carry out errands in safety.

But this year, Clare County Council has submitted a notice of intention to close Salt House Lane and High Street, restricting access at peak times for all traffic.

Ennis Fine Gael Councillor Johnny Flynn is concerned about the impact it would have on those driving into town from other parts of Clare.
